Whether played socially or professionally, idn poker is a very popular card game worldwide. It can be played in virtually any country, and has many variations. Although the exact origin of poker is not completely clear, it is regarded as a descendant of games with similar names, such as brelan, primero and poque.

Poker is played with a 52-card deck. Each player is dealt a hand of five cards. The player’s goal is to make the best possible hand. Poker is often played in private homes and can be played for pennies or thousands of dollars. Usually, the players place a bet on their hand, and the pot is awarded to the player with the best hand. If two players are tied, the players split the pot.
